2015 IESA Scholastic Bowl State Finals to be Held at Peoria Civic Center on Friday, May 8; Championship Matches to be Webcast

For the fourth consecutive year the Illinois Elementary School Association (IESA) Scholastic Bowl State Finals will be held in Peoria at the Civic Center this Friday (May 8). The IESA state series in Scholastic Bowl began in 1988 although a state final was not held the first year. There was one-class competition from 1989-1996, and in 1997 the state series was divided into Class A and Class AA based on school size. This is the 27th year of state series competition in Scholastic Bowl and the 19th year for Class A and Class AA competition.

A total of 16 teams will play in Peoria--eight teams in Class A and eight teams in Class AA. All teams participating will play three rounds. Each class is divided into two pools of four teams. The winners of each pool will meet for the championship of their respective class while the runners-up in each pool will play for 3rd place honors in round 4. Assignment to each pool was done by a blind draw. Competition gets underway at 1:00 p.m. in both classes. Subsequent matches are scheduled for 2:00 p.m. and 3:00 p.m. After an hour break for dinner, the third place and championship matches will be played at 5:00 p.m. The awards assembly will begin immediately after the conclusion of the final round.

The Peoria Civic Center is hosting the IESA state finals for the fourth time. Prior to the move to the Civic Center, the IESA state finals were held at Heartland Community College in Normal for a total of six years. The Civic Center provides a beautiful venue for the finals and all matches will be conducted in the 4th floor ballroom.

The price of admission is $5.00 for adults and $2.00 for seniors (62 and over) and students (K-8), and is good for the entire tournament. Children younger than kindergarten are admitted free. Fans attending the matches will receive a wristband that is to be worn all day and will be used for entry into the facility throughout the day.

This year, 364 member schools entered the state series in Scholastic Bowl. Questions used throughout the state series are provided by Questions Galore, while the lockout systems are provided by Slammer Systems.

For the fourth straight year, the lock-out systems that will be used at the IESA state finals will be provided by Slammer Systems. Slammer Systems automatically keeps score, manages time, controls the ring-in process, and produces detailed statistic spreadsheets for every match.

In addition, the IESA and Slammer Systems will be broadcasting the Class A and AA Championship matches online.
